Do you have to check valves installed correctly? Thin side should be facing the water and fat side facing the doser.... having them installed the wrong way will prevent the solutions from flowing.

If that is correct... make sure you have the tubing installed correctly. Maybe you reversed the tubing on the dosing heads?

If all that is correct you need to give the fluid time to flow from the source into the tank... use the cylinder to hold overflow once the lines are primed.

If all that is done then I’m out of ideas.

I used check valves, I don't think they are necessary but not a bad safety feature. The arrows should be in the direction of flow, so pump to tank placed after the dosing container and as close to the drop doser (if using one) as possible.

It’s not supposed to form a siphon because they are peristaltic pumps. The check valves, I assume, are for the freak occurrence, and to give us type “A” people a little more peace of mind

AWC Improvement Need:
I have only one improvement need or any suggestions to solve are welcome
I use AWC DC pumps when I calbirate DC Pump1 (Dirty Water) it never loose calibration as water level in Sump is stable so the head pressure is not changing.

However for fresh mix salt water DC pump this is not the case as head pressure is changing due to the water level decrease. I am using Vertical Style 100 Litres water tank probably 80cm height 40cm diameter. I observe each 2 days need to reduce the calibration amount approx 10ml. Is it possible to add a ratio for this so it will automatically update the DC Pump calibration? Or Maybe an option to enable Fresh Mix Tank size can be entered and then make some head pressure calculations etc according to water level (percentage of filled level) Now I need to change calibration amount every 2 days.
